Which intervention is an example of secondary prevention?

a. Developing policies and procedures for referral programs
b. Designing protocols for lead screening
c. Serving as a chair to organize a smallpox vaccination program
d. Monitoring implementation of performance-improvement activities


B
Screening is performed at the secondary level of prevention.
